Structural Safety Comes First
Every roof is varied. RCC roofs handle heavy loads, while metal sheets may only sustain 30–50 kg/m². Get it wrong, and risks include cracks, leaks, sagging.
Wind is even crucial. IS 875 standards show storms test structures. Poorly anchored arrays break free, as seen in recent storms.
Professional EPCs plan for wind, unlike corner-cutters.
The Science of Tilt & Orientation
Optimal tilt = geography. Example: Delhi ~28°, Pune ~18°, Chennai ~13°. Even small errors reduce yield by 2–3%. Over 25 years, that’s lakhs in savings gone.
Shading hurts output. One obstacle can reduce string generation by 30%. Professionals analyze shadows to avoid loss.

Cable Sizing: The Silent Profit Killer
Cables are arteries. Wrong size = waste.
• Keep DC drop <1.5%, AC <2%. Exceeding reduces generation.
• Undersized cables burn profits daily.
• UV protection is must — cheap cables crack in 2–3 years. Professionals use TUV-certified cables.
Inverters: The Brains
The inverter optimizes output.
• Modern efficiency = 97–99%. Even 1% loss over 25 years = lakhs gone.
• Sizing matters. Slight undersize helps ROI; big undersize = clipping. Oversize = wasted money.
• Redundancy matters. Multiple inverters = lower downtime. Case: Gujarat 250 kW plant saw 18% downtime; after distributed inverters, downtime <1%.

Maintenance: The ROI Multiplier
• Panel cleaning prevents 5–15% loss.
• Preventive = ?500 fix early. Corrective = ?50,000 loss later.
• Well-maintained plants run >99% availability. Poor ones drop below 93%.
